WebIt's easy to confuse although and however because they're both used to show a contrast between ideas. But they aren't the same kind of word. Although is used to start a dependent clause (DC). However is used to link two independent clauses (IC) that have a full stop between them. See if you have mastered the use of these words by trying our quiz! WebApr 12, 2024 · The words however, moreover, furthermore , therefore, thus and consequently are transitional adverbs, not conjunctions. As you know conjunctions are words used to connect two clauses. Transitional adverbs, on the other hand, cannot connect two clauses. They merely ensure the flow of ideas between sentences and paragraphs.

WebThese include the following: however, moreover, therefore, thus, consequently, furthermore, unfortunately. Most of the time, problems occur when the writer uses a conjunctive adverb in the middle of a sentence when a coordinating conjunction is actually needed.
